BAM Outsource on Success and Goal Setting
We’re always told to try our best and then we’ll probably succeed. In practice that's true, but Geoffrey James believes that the three little words, “I will try…” set you up to fail. BAM Outsource looks at the skill in goal setting.

He believes that people who say “I will try” have already given themselves permission to fail, because they can always placate themselves by saying, “at least I tried” when things go wrong. The problem is two way though. The person on the receiving end is also fooled into thinking that the speaker will actually succeed.

“The idea actually makes a lot of sense”, said Ben Knowles, Managing Director of BAM Outsource. “If you close the back-door and remove the option for failure then you’re much more likely to fight hard and see through your goals.”

Goal setting is hugely important to individuals who want to succeed. BAM Outsource feels that it provides focus on what you’re doing and makes a big task achievable. When you’re setting your goals make sure that they stretch you, but that they’re also achievable. Finally don’t give yourself any room for failure.

Mr. Knowles is well aware of the importance of being able to set goals. “At BAM Outsource we work to very high standards and results. We measure our goals daily, weekly, monthly and yearly. Our advice for the best way to achieve your goals is simple. Tell someone whose respect you value, what you’re going to do, why you’re doing it and when it will be done by. Then set yourself a timescale with checkpoints along the way. You’ll be able to measure your progress more easily and work out when you’re getting behind and when you’re ahead of schedule. Finally don’t give yourself any wiggle room to back out. You’ve made a commitment, now go and do it!”
